***Macrium Reflect Issue Solved***
I ran dism cleanup image and dism restore health commands.
Then I ran chkdsk c: /f /r and restarted my pc so it could run and went to sleep for a few hours.
I just tried Macrium Reflect again to make a system image and it worked this time.

and Edge extensionsI've personally noticed 3 issues in Windows 10 Fall Creators Update.
Issue 1: Disk Cleanup - Freezes up everytime it's run.
I know it's done, as I give it twice as long as it took in Creators Update, Anniversary Update and previous 10 versions.
Disk Cleanup windows on drive D: (2nd ssd) and drive E: (Data hdd don't close until I click on Disk Cleanup for the next drive and they never show any progress.
Issue 2: Wired Ethernet connection takes forever to have internet access at startup. Intel Ethernet drivers up to date and configured exactly as I set it in previous Windows 10 versions.
Issue 3. Microsoft killed Disk Image Backups in Fall Creators Update, so why is the Disk Image option still listed and appears to work until the very end and the says image failed.
Those are the 3 I've experienced with a clean install and I've heard their's more that other people have with FCU.
Oh, I forgot one I've personally noticed.
The Store lists downloaded themes and Edge extensions in the start menu until you run disk cleanup and restart your pc.
